Content Security Policy: A Thorough Guide

Content Security Policy (CSP) is a critical feature that allows you to specify the assets that the application is permitted to load for your web page. This protection defense helps mitigate various forms of XSS attacks , injection vulnerabilities, and alternative security threats . By precisely configuring CSP directives, you can notably reduce the vulnerability exposure and enhance the overall security posture of your online platform . Understanding how to utilize CSP is a important step for any present-day online architect .

Web Security Policy Implementation: A Phase -by- By- Approach

To properly implement a robust Content Security Policy (CSP), a logical approach is vital. Initially, begin by reviewing your present web application’s resources and identifying their origins . Then , create a initial CSP directive allowing all from your own domain. Slowly limit allowed sources, validating each change in a safe area before pushing it to production. Use the report-to directive for receiving CSP violation reports to further refine your policy. Keep in mind to carefully track your application after deploying the CSP to guarantee compatibility and resolve any unforeseen issues.
